&lt;/blockquote&gt;</description><link>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/35861783731</link><guid>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/35861783731</guid><pubDate>Fri, 16 Nov 2012 13:35:54 -0800</pubDate><category>glutenfree celiacandthebeast</category></item><item><title>I eat a lot of processed GF cereals and processed GF snacks,  would multiplying these products that state &lt;20ppm add up over a day to cause a reaction.  I have confirmed dermatitis herpetiformis.</title><description>&lt;p&gt;Yes, it is possible. A person would need to eat 1 kilogram of a food with 20ppm to consume 20mg of gluten. This is why it is important to have variety in your diet including fruits and vegetables that are naturally gf.&lt;/p&gt;</description><link>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/35860331562</link><guid>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/35860331562</guid><pubDate>Fri, 16 Nov 2012 13:14:12 -0800</pubDate></item><item><title>WHEN I LEAVE A RESTAURANT BECAUSE I CAN'T EAT ANYTHING</title><description>&lt;p&gt;&lt;a class="tumblr_blog" href="http://wheniwentglutenfree.tumblr.com/post/30585960632/when-i-leave-a-restaurant-because-i-cant-eat-anything" target="_blank"&gt;wheniwentglutenfree&lt;/a&gt;:&lt;/p&gt;

And fun too! &lt;/p&gt;</description><link>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/31278385680</link><guid>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/31278385680</guid><pubDate>Mon, 10 Sep 2012 10:56:30 -0700</pubDate></item><item><title>How can I be supportive of my friend who was just diagnosed with celiac? I want to help make things easier for her. What's the best way for me to do this? Thank you!</title><description>&lt;p&gt;It sounds like you’re already being a good friend by asking! First I would be willing to listen and know that the first year after diagnosis is usually the hardest; it will take her awhile to accept the life change and learn new habits. Second, I would recommend cooking something for her! Learn as much about celiac disease as you can. Invite her over for dinner and cook her a completely gluten-free meal (make sure to clean your kitchen well to prevent cross-contamination), or bring gluten-free cookies to a social event you are both attending. It means SO much when someone goes out of their way to feed you when you find it so difficult to feed yourself!&lt;/p&gt;</description><link>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/31278130978</link><guid>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/31278130978</guid><pubDate>Mon, 10 Sep 2012 10:50:28 -0700</pubDate></item><item><title>How did you become a summer intern?????? Contact &lt;a href="mailto:cdf@celiac.org" target="_blank"&gt;cdf@celiac.org&lt;/a&gt; for more information if you are interested!&lt;/p&gt;</description><link>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/30326039078</link><guid>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/30326039078</guid><pubDate>Mon, 27 Aug 2012 11:02:46 -0700</pubDate></item><item><title>What can you do if you happen to eat non gluten free food by accident, to help settle your body down?  My sister has had incidents where a restaurant said a meal was gluten free but then used sauces that made her stomach upset.</title><description>&lt;p&gt;Once the gluten gets to the intestinal tract, there’s really no way to go back or reverse the damage. I have found Pepto Bismol and Immodium to be helpful when I have upset stomach, cramps, and diarrhea. Unfortunately I haven’t found any over-the-counter medications to be helpful for bloating or gas! This is a great question for your sister to ask her doctor. They will be more familiar with everything that is available.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;I also sometimes find that I need to avoid high-fiber or spicy foods after I get “glutened”. My system seems to be more irritable for a couple days. Every person is different, though, and it’s important generally to eat fiber.&lt;/p&gt;</description><link>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/30003506827</link><guid>http://youngandglutenfree.com/post/30003506827</guid><pubDate>Wed, 22 Aug 2012 18:20:12 -0700</pubDate></item><item><title>I was diagnosed with Celiacs about a month ago and I am completely overwhelmed! I do not even know where to being. Do you have any good tips for people who are just starting out? Are there cretin things I need to look for that I would not think of?  Thank you!</title><description>&lt;p&gt;It IS overwhelming, but know that it definitely WILL get better! I think my first year was the roughest, and after that it got easier and easier. I suggest not eating out at restaurants until you get comfortable with the diet and all the questions that need to be asked. I got glutened so many times eating at restaurants because I didn’t think the salad dressing would have gluten, or chicken breast would be marinated in soy sauce, or that the tortilla chips were fried along with the chalupas.  I would also get very overwhelmed with ordering and felt embarassed or pressured when I was talking to servers or restaurant workers about the menu. It will be trial and error, but you will need to talk to chefs, managers, and servers in detail to make sure that your meal is gluten-free.&lt;/p&gt;
